Abstract
An apparatus for circulating air includes a barrel through which the air is circulated, where the barrel includes a body having a first end and a second end, and a coil positioned near the second end of the barrel for controlling when the air is permitted to circulate through the barrel. In another embodiment, an apparatus for circulating air includes a grating through which the air is circulated and an actuator for controlling when the air is permitted to circulate through the grating, wherein the actuator is activated automatically in response to changes in ambient temperature without requiring a supply of electricity.

1 . An apparatus for circulating air, the apparatus comprising:
a barrel through which the air is circulated, the barrel including a body having a first end and a second end; and a coil positioned near the second end of the barrel for controlling when the air is permitted to circulate through the barrel.
2 . The apparatus of claim 1 , further comprising:
a door attached to the coil and positioned concentrically around the barrel, the door including an opening that exposes the barrel when the door is rotated.
3 . The apparatus of claim 1 , wherein the body of the barrel includes a plurality of apertures.
4 . The apparatus of claim 1 , wherein the coil comprises a spiral of a bimetallic material.
5 . The apparatus of claim 4 , wherein the bimetallic material comprises:
a first layer comprising a first metal that expands at a first rate when heated; and a second layer comprising a second metal that expands at a second rate when heated, wherein the second rate is different from the first rate.
6 . The apparatus of claim 1 , further comprising:
a spool positioned near the second end of the barrel, wherein the coil is mounted to the spool.
7 . The apparatus of claim 6 , wherein an end of the coil is secured by a notch in the spool.
8 . The apparatus of claim 1 , further comprising:
a housing within which the barrel and the coil are contained.
9 . The apparatus of claim 8 , wherein the housing has a substantially cylindrical shape.
10 . The apparatus of claim 8 , wherein an end of the coil is secured by a notch in the housing.
11 . A vent for circulating air, the vent comprising:
a housing, the housing having a substantially cylindrical shape; a barrel positioned inside the housing, the barrel including a plurality of apertures though which the air is circulated; a door positioned concentrically between the barrel and the housing, the door having a substantially cylindrical shape and an opening formed therein; and a coil attached to one end of the door, such that the door is rotatable with the coil, wherein the coil is formed from a bimetallic material.
12 . The vent of claim 11 , wherein the barrel includes a plurality of apertures formed therein.
13 . The vent of claim 11 , wherein the coil comprises a spiral of a bimetallic material.
14 . The vent of claim 13 , wherein the bimetallic material comprises:
a first layer comprising a first metal that expands at a first rate when heated; and a second layer comprising a second metal that expands at a second rate when heated, wherein the second rate is different from the first rate.
15 . The vent of claim 11 , wherein the housing has a substantially cylindrical shape.
16 . An apparatus for circulating air, the apparatus comprising:
a grating through which the air is circulated; and an actuator for controlling when the air is permitted to circulate through the grating, wherein the actuator is activated automatically in response to changes in ambient temperature without requiring a supply of electricity.
17 . The apparatus of claim 16 , wherein the grating comprises:
a barrel having a plurality of apertures formed therein.
18 . The apparatus of claim 17 , wherein the apparatus further comprises:
a housing having a substantially cylindrical shape; and a door having a substantially cylindrical shape and an opening formed therein, the door being positioned between the housing and the grating.
19 . The apparatus of claim 18 , wherein the actuator comprises:
a coil attached to the door, the coil being formed from a bimetallic material.
